Abstract

The invention relates to a liquefied gas furnace-heating method of a refractory lining castable of a heating furnace module. The liquefied gas furnace-heating method of the refractory lining castable of the heating furnace module comprises the following steps that 1, assembly of the module preparing to be furnace-heated is completed, the top of the module is provided with a temporary chimney, everywhere of the module is sealed tightly by using a refractory material, and burning equipment, air collecting and conveying equipment, air leaking monitor equipment, thermocouples and temperature detector equipment are assembled; 2, ignition is conducted, specially, according to the technology requirements, temperature curve controls changes of temperature, and an furnace-heating process is completed; and 3, equipment is dismantled when the temperature drops to indoor temperature. According to the liquefied gas furnace-heating method of the refractory lining castable of the heating furnace module, fire power of burning of liquefied gas is controlled, the temperature around the castable to be dried is controlled, by using the proper temperature changing curve, free water and bound water in the castable are slowly evaporated, it is ensured that the water content in the castable drops to a safe range, and the fact that high temperature generated during on-site using does not cause cracking and damage of the castable is ensured.

technical field [0001] The invention relates to a liquefied gas oven method, in particular to a liquefied gas oven method for heating furnace module refractory lining castables. Background technique [0002] The lining of the high-temperature reformer will use refractory castables, and a certain amount of water will be added during the stirring process during pouring. If the construction process does not pass through the oven, the sudden high temperature in the equipment will be much higher than 100°C when it is used on site, which will make the The moisture inside the castable evaporates rapidly, and the water vapor pressure generated is greater than the bonding force of the castable, resulting in cracking and damage to the castable.
